
Bear NPC
I am intrigued by the idea of 'neutral' creatures, despite how poorly they work with the rules of MTG. This proof concept works comparatively OK by virtue of simplicity; the player has some built in edge (takes 1 less damage, is green and has ramp+big blockers) and I like the flavor. I'm just not sure there's a cost where you would actually want to play it, but wouldn't feel bad from an opponent playing it. Food for thought.
The name is from the old joke that when a bear chases you and your friend, you don't need to outrun the bear, only your friend.
